  • In terms of popularization: Office space: With the popularity of open office spaces and the emphasis on employee privacy and a focused work environment, the popularity of silent cabins in office spaces will continue to increase. It can provide employees with independent conference calls, video conferences, spaces for focused work or group discussions, improving work efficiency. For example, in the future, more companies may include silent cabins as standard equipment in their offices, such as large technology and financial companies that have high requirements for office environments.
  • In the field of education, the demand for silent cabins in school libraries, study rooms, classrooms, and other places will continue to increase. Students can engage in group learning, reading, oral practice, and other activities in the silent cabin without external interference, thus improving their learning effectiveness. In addition, some examination institutions may also use silent cabins as special examination rooms to provide a quiet examination environment for examinees.
  • Public spaces: In public spaces such as airports, train stations, libraries, museums, etc., silent cabins can provide temporary rest, work, or study spaces for people. People can work, read books, or rest in quiet cabins while waiting for flights, trains, or visiting exhibitions, meeting their demand for quiet spaces in public places.
  • In the medical field, silent cabins can be installed in hospital waiting areas, doctor's offices, psychological counseling rooms, and other places to provide patients with a quiet waiting environment, protect patients' privacy, and also provide doctors with a quiet diagnostic and counseling space.
